Gentoo Archives: gentoo-commits

From: Marek Szuba <marecki@g.o>
To: gentoo-commits@l.g.o
Subject: [gentoo-commits] repo/gentoo:master commit in: net-analyzer/suricata/
Date: Thu, 23 Apr 2020 21:12:00
Message-Id: 1587676248.a061032bd203f7986591189957a1008aecc9268a.marecki@gentoo
1 commit: a061032bd203f7986591189957a1008aecc9268a
2 Author: Marek Szuba <marecki <AT> gentoo <DOT> org>
3 AuthorDate: Thu Apr 23 20:59:56 2020 +0000
4 Commit: Marek Szuba <marecki <AT> gentoo <DOT> org>
5 CommitDate: Thu Apr 23 21:10:48 2020 +0000
6 URL: https://gitweb.gentoo.org/repo/gentoo.git/commit/?id=a061032b
7
8 net-analyzer/suricata: add missing "|| die" guard to sed call
9
10 Also, some cosmetic changes to dependencies.
11
12 Signed-off-by: Marek Szuba <marecki <AT> gentoo.org>
13
14 net-analyzer/suricata/suricata-5.0.2.ebuild | 11 +++++------
15 1 file changed, 5 insertions(+), 6 deletions(-)
16
17 diff --git a/net-analyzer/suricata/suricata-5.0.2.ebuild b/net-analyzer/suricata/suricata-5.0.2.ebuild
18 index 19940f3c9fb..b2dc6c2e8b0 100644
19 --- a/net-analyzer/suricata/suricata-5.0.2.ebuild
20 +++ b/net-analyzer/suricata/suricata-5.0.2.ebuild
21 @@ -22,7 +22,8 @@ REQUIRED_USE="${PYTHON_REQUIRED_USE}
22 ?? ( lua luajit )
23 bpf? ( af-packet )"
24
25 -CDEPEND="acct-group/suricata
26 +RDEPEND="${PYTHON_DEPS}
27 + acct-group/suricata
28 acct-user/suricata
29 dev-libs/jansson
30 dev-libs/libpcre
31 @@ -32,7 +33,7 @@ CDEPEND="acct-group/suricata
32 dev-libs/nspr
33 dev-libs/nss
34 $(python_gen_cond_dep '
35 - dev-python/pyyaml[${PYTHON_MULTI_USEDEP}]
36 + dev-python/pyyaml[${PYTHON_USEDEP}]
37 ')
38 >=net-libs/libhtp-0.5.32
39 net-libs/libpcap
40 @@ -48,11 +49,9 @@ CDEPEND="acct-group/suricata
41 nflog? ( net-libs/libnetfilter_log )
42 nfqueue? ( net-libs/libnetfilter_queue )
43 redis? ( dev-libs/hiredis )"
44 -DEPEND="${CDEPEND}
45 +DEPEND="${RDEPEND}
46 >=sys-devel/autoconf-2.69-r5
47 virtual/rust"
48 -RDEPEND="${CDEPEND}
49 - ${PYTHON_DEPS}"
50
51 PATCHES=(
52 "${FILESDIR}/${PN}-5.0.1_configure-no-lz4-automagic.patch"
53 @@ -74,7 +73,7 @@ pkg_pretend() {
54
55 src_prepare() {
56 default
57 - sed -ie 's/docdir =.*/docdir = ${datarootdir}\/doc\/'${PF}'\//' "${S}/doc/Makefile.am"
58 + sed -ie 's/docdir =.*/docdir = ${datarootdir}\/doc\/'${PF}'\//' "${S}/doc/Makefile.am" || die
59 eautoreconf
60 }